Bladeren bron

removed useless updatemaster

Anselm R. Garbe 19 jaren geleden
bovenliggende
commit
010fd21b20
4 gewijzigde bestanden met toevoegingen van 3 en 9 verwijderingen
  1. 1 1
      config.arg.h
  2. 0 1
      dwm.h
  3. 1 1
      main.c
  4. 1 6
      view.c

+ 1 - 1
config.arg.h

@@ -8,7 +8,7 @@ const char *tags[] = { "dev", "work", "net", "fnord", NULL };
 
 #define DEFMODE			dotile		/* dofloat */
 #define FLOATSYMBOL		"><>"
-#define STACKPOS		StackRight	/* StackLeft */
+#define STACKPOS		StackRight	/* StackLeft, StackBottom */
 #define TILESYMBOL		"[]="
 
 #define FONT			"-*-terminus-medium-*-*-*-12-*-*-*-*-*-iso10646-*"

+ 0 - 1
dwm.h

@@ -174,7 +174,6 @@ extern void restack(void);			/* restores z layers of all clients */
 extern void togglestackpos(Arg *arg);		/* toggles stack position */
 extern void togglemode(Arg *arg);		/* toggles global arrange function (dotile/dofloat) */
 extern void toggleview(Arg *arg);		/* toggles the tag with arg's index (in)visible */
-extern void updatemaster(void);			/* updates master dimension */
 extern void view(Arg *arg);			/* views the tag with arg's index */
 extern void viewall(Arg *arg);			/* views all tags, arg is ignored */
 extern void zoom(Arg *arg);			/* zooms the focused client to master area, arg is ignored */

+ 1 - 1
main.c

@@ -133,7 +133,7 @@ setup(void) {
 	sx = sy = 0;
 	sw = DisplayWidth(dpy, screen);
 	sh = DisplayHeight(dpy, screen);
-	updatemaster();
+	master = ((stackpos == StackBottom ? sh - bh : sw) * MASTER) / 100;
 
 	bx = by = 0;
 	bw = sw;

+ 1 - 6
view.c

@@ -340,13 +340,8 @@ togglestackpos(Arg *arg) {
 		stackpos = STACKPOS;
 	else
 		stackpos = StackBottom;
-	updatemaster();
-	arrange(NULL);
-}
-
-void
-updatemaster(void) {
 	master = ((stackpos == StackBottom ? sh - bh : sw) * MASTER) / 100;
+	arrange(NULL);
 }
 
 void